Front Subframe Assembly

Front Subframe Assembly The Front Subframe Assembly is a critical structural chassis component in modern vehicles, forming the foundational backbone of the front suspension system. Often referred to as a cradle or crossmember, it is a robust, welded metal frame that is securely bolted to the vehicle’s unibody or chassis. Its primary function is to […]

Rear Seat Belt Assembly

The Rear Seat Belt Assembly is a critical safety system designed to protect passengers in the back seats of a vehicle during a collision or sudden stop. It is a complete, integrated unit typically consisting of a retractor mechanism, webbing, a buckle, and a tongue plate. This assembly works in unison to secure the occupant, […]
